The Harvest
At The Harvest Church, we believe every soul matters deeply to God, and our mission is to nurture personal growth, discipleship, and faith one person at a time.
Rather than focusing on numbers, we prioritize quality over quantity—investing in meaningful relationships, fostering spiritual transformation, and equipping each individual to grow in grace and serve in God’s harvest. By focusing on the power of personal connection, we aim to build a strong, faithful community that reflects God’s love and truth in every city and nation.
Our Vision
To reach every city and nation with compassion, teaching and preaching the Gospel of Jesus Christ, and seeing hearts transformed by His love and truth.

Bishop Otis M. Davis II
Founder & Pastor of The Harvest Church
Bishop Davis, a Columbia, SC native, has dedicated his life to ministry and the salvation of souls. Baptized and filled with the Holy Spirit at age 14 under Pastor M.J. Fields, he began serving as a Deacon, Youth Sunday School Teacher, and Youth Department President. Called to ministry in 1976, he has faithfully led and served in various capacities, including his ordination as a Bishop in 2010 under the Apostolic Churches of Jesus Christ, Inc.
A devoted husband to Lady Hattie Davis, father of three daughters, and proud grandfather, Bishop Davis emphasizes the transformative power of Christ. Rooted in Acts 4:12, his mission is clear: to preach salvation through the name of Jesus and guide others toward a life-changing relationship with Him.
